Answer:
E)Debit Supplies Expense $850 and credit Supplies $850.
Explanation:
The inventory/supplies balance at the end of the period in which a count was conducted has to be adjusted to reflect the amount of stock/supplies available at the end of the period.
Given that the count indicates that there are $1,250 of supplies on hand and the book balance is $2,100,
The difference is
= $2,100 - $1,250
= $850
Entries required
Debit Supplies Expense $850
Credit Supplies $850.

Answer
In a mixed market economy, the typical way the government can reduce unemployment is : The government can pay for projects to create work
Explanation
In a mixed market economy, part of the economy is left to the free market and part of it is managed by the government. In a mixed economy, private enterprise run most businesses and the government later intervene in areas like provision of public services( education, health care and waste control), and in the regulation (legal right to private property). Most modern economies are mixed where the means of production are shared between the private and public sectors.
